Steps
- 1
Yeast Proofing at first----
Take warm water in a bowl, add yeast add sugar to it. Cover with lid. After 10 minutes you will see all frothy texture on the top, don’t disturb. Keep it aside. This shows that yeast is still active. - 2
In a wide bowl, take the flour, add the yeast mix. Then add the salt. butter and curds. Crumble well. Slowly knead to soft pliable dough. Punch it well for couple of minutes.
- 3
Cover with a wet muslin cloth and keep it in a warm place for 1 -2 hrs. Once done, remove the cover, punch it down again.
- 4
Divide into small balls, dust it in flour. Roll them into oval shapes. Make the whole batch while the oven gets heated up. Pre heat the oven at 500°F.
- 5
Add the stuffing in it and roll the naan.
- 6
Place the rolled out Naan on the tray, bake for 10 minutes. Remove, turn and continue baking for another 3-5 minutes.
- 7
Remove and quickly apply butter on it and serve.
